RPLCMD.EXE使用详解 张利辉 2000年 第33期   在设置NT远程启动网络时,一般先要安装NetBEUI和DLC协议,再安装和启动远程启动服务,随后使用RPLCMD.EXE对无盘工作站的网卡进行配置,最后安装无盘工作站。前面的两步相对比较简单,不易出错,但是在第三步无盘工作站网卡的配置过程中却容易出现问题。而在各种相关资料中一般只有某种特定网卡的配置方法,很难看到有介绍RPLCMD.EXE一般的使用方法。为了使大家更加熟练地掌握NT远程启动的设置方法,下面对RPLCMD.EXE进行一个详细的描述   RPLCMD.EXE位于WINNT\SYSTEM32目录下,是Windows NT远程启动设置时经常使用的一个非常重要的交互式工具,它可以用来查看和更新远程启动服务数据库。该命令的格式如下:   RPLCMD [\\计算机名]   其中[\\计算机名]用于指定远程启动服务器的计算机名,一般情况下我们在服务器上进行设置,因而可以省略它。   在远程启动服务启动之后,我们就可以在NT的MS-DOS方式之下键入RPLCMD,随后就会出现下面的提示信息,并等待用户的输入:   适配器引导Config配置文件服务代理商Wksta[退出]   我们可以在后面键入下面的八个命令之一(只需要输入第一个字母):   A(Adapter):用于修改不完整的网卡记录。   B(Boot):用于修改Boot Block记录,可设置网卡驱动程序文件(CNF文件)的路径。   C(Config):用于修改配置记录,可指定系统目录映射关系文件(FIT文件)的路径。   P(Profile):用于修改配置文件。   S(Service):用于控制远程启动服务。   V(Vendor):用于配置网卡厂商编码(即网卡ID的前六位数字)和网卡名称。   W(Wksta):修改工作站记录。   Q(Quit):退出本程序。   键入上述命令之后,系统一般都提示Add Del Enum,有一些命令还可能提示Getinfo和Setinfo,这时就可以使用下面五条命令之一,完成相应的操作:   A(Add):添加一条记录。   D(Delete):删除一条记录。   E(Enumerate):显示记录。   G(Get information):获得记录信息。   S(Set information):设置记录信息。   上面有的命令可能还需要一些参数决定回显信息的多少,一般是0,1,2三个数字,数字越大显示的信息越丰富   下面将设置网卡的一般顺序介绍一下:   运行RPLCMD之后,先使用V命令设置VendorName(网卡厂商编码,即网卡ID的前六位数字)和VendorComment(网卡名称,可自定义,如MyNe2000),其他参数可以不输入。如果你的网卡硬件地址前六位不全相同,则可能需要多次使用本命令。若需要同时安装DOS和WIN95,对同类网卡此步骤只需要一次;   然后,使用B命令增加网卡的BOOT BLOCK记录,这时可以只输入BootName(启动名称,可以自定义,如MyBoot)、VendorName(网卡ID的前六位数字,和V命令中的相同)以及Bbcfile(CNF文件的相对路径和名称),其它的部分可以不输入;   最后,使用C命令添加可用配置记录,需要的参数是ConfigName(配置名称,自定义,如MyConfig,但不能和已有的配置重名)、BootName(与上一步的BootName一致)、目录名(DirName、DirName2)、共享和私有目录映射关系文件(.CNF文件:FitsShared、FitsPersonal)和ConfigComment(将来要显示出来的注释说明)。   至此,我们就将网卡的启动配置设置好了,启动远程启动管理器,检查配置和修复安全性就可以使用刚设置好的配置记录了。如果看不到或不能使用新设置的配置记录,就说明在刚才的设置过程中出现了问题,需要重新使用RPLCMD的E(num)或D(elete)子命令对设置进行修改。